Active Ingredients
Streptococcus Salivarius K12 Bacteria.
Inactive Ingredients
Isomalt, Tableting Aids, Vanilla Flavour, Skim Milk Powder.
Product Description
Blis K12 Throat Guard lozenges are designed to provide natural bacterial support for a healthy throat. Blis K12 lozenges contain naturally occurring, beneficial bacteria called Streptococcus Salivarius K12. The bacteria has been shown to assist in maintaining throat health by supporting the throats natural defences against undesirable bacteria. Each pack of Blis K12 throat guard contains 12 lozenges with each lozenge containing no less than one hundred million viable cells of Streptococcus Salivarius K12.

Streptococcus Salivarius K12 is the result of many years of scientific research, observation and testing by an internationally recognised research team, working in collaboration with a leading university to identify the most beneficial strain of naturally occurring bacteria that assists in maintaining a healthy throat.
Blis K12 should be used to guard the throat when:
- Following the use of antibiotics for a bacterial infection. Antibiotics are an appropriate and effective treatment for throat infections and many other diseases but as well as eliminating the harmful bacteria, they can also eliminate beneficial bacteria. By using Blis K12 Throat Guard within 24 hours of completing a prescribed course of antibiotics, you can help insure that beneficial rather than undesirable bacteria repopulate the mouth and throat.
- In conjunction with pharmacy medicines for sore throats that have anti-bacterial or anti-viral properties. Likewise these products can affect levels of beneficial bacteria as well as the harmful micro-organisms, and Blis K12 Throat Guard can help maintain that a good bacterial balance is maintained.

For best results use as directed, and repeat monthly. If the course of Blis K12 lozenges is started within 24 hours of completing a course of antibiotics, the Chlorhexidine mouthwash is not required. If you have a persistent sore throat see your doctor.
Dosage
Adults and children over 3 years
- Day 1 - First 10ml of Chlorhexidine mouthwash, swirl in the mouth for 30 seconds and then expel. Take the first Blis k12 lozenge 2 hours later and suck slowly in the mouth. Take a further 3 lozenges at 2 ? 4 hour intervals.
- Day 2 and 3 - Repeat the dosage as per day 1 using the mouth wash and then taking 4 lozenges at 2 ? 4 hour intervals.
